Fun facts about sister cities

History, art, culture, language, or just having a funny name mean these famous places are somehow related… “Twin towns”, “sister cities”, “friendship towns”, whatever you call them, the idea is basically the same: some sort of legal and social link between towns, cities or regions. Although there had been a couple of examples of links […]

